Beautifullymixed · 01/03/2020 23:42

Me too Hermione it really does shrink them doesn't it!

I also rate glycolic acid, as well as oil cleansing for really cleaning out the pores and keeping them under control.

I have been using Elf poreless putty primer lately, and love the hydrating and smoothing effect.
I also dot a bit of Maybelline baby skin on my nose pores before foundation too.

Lastly, I press setting powder firmly into the pores with a damp beauty sponge.
Bare minerals mineral veil, Too face peach setting powder, Elf HD powder and Innisfree no sebum powder work really well for this.
My pores are as small as they ever will be.
